Dallas changing plans to ban gas-powered lawn equipment amid new state law


July 20, 2023

Dallas is changing its plans to ban residents and businesses from using gas-powered lawn mowers and other landscaping equipment because of a new state law that goes into effect in September. Senate Bill 1017, which was signed into law by Gov. Greg Abbott in May, blocks a city, county, school district and other authorities from limiting or banning the use, sale or …

Excessive heat warning in effect for Dallas-Fort Worth ahead of cooler temperatures


July 20, 2023

Temperatures are expected to slightly decrease by the weekend but Thursday’s heat is still dangerous, according to meteorologists. The National Weather Service issued an excessive heat warning for all of North Texas that expires at 8 p.m. Thursday. The warning is in place for areas that will reach temperatures of 105 or greater and heat indices of 110 or more, …

Texas abortion access hearing: Here is what’s at stake


July 19, 2023

Four Texas women are set to testify that their abortions for medically-complicated pregnancies were denied or delayed as part of a hearing to determine if a Travis County court will block the state’s abortion ban in similar situations — or whether it will throw the case out altogether. The case — Zurawski vs. State of Texas — now includes 13 women who …

Dallas North Tollway expansion continues as sprawl surges north


July 19, 2023

Now that the Dallas North Tollway extension over the U.S. 380 bridge is open and easing congestion in Frisco, Prosper and Celina, work to widen the highway continues in Frisco. The U.S. 380 bridge’s southbound entrance opened Feb. 20 and the northbound lane opened March 11, and 11,000 vehicles traveled that stretch of the DNT on opening day in February, according …
